How Visual Identity Shapes Dining Decisions
Visual identity plays a crucial role in how customers perceive a restaurant. This includes logo design, color schemes, packaging, and even staff uniforms. A strong visual identity creates instant recognition and builds emotional connections. When customers see a familiar design, they associate it with past experiences, taste expectations, and service quality. In crowded food courts or busy streets, a clear and attractive brand image can be the deciding factor that draws customers inside rather than passing by.
The Role of Consistency Across All Touchpoints
Consistency is one of the most powerful branding tools in hospitality. From digital platforms to in-store experiences, customers expect the same level of quality everywhere. Consistent branding across menus, signage, staff appearance, and customer communication builds trust. When menu updates align with the overall brand voice and visuals, they feel intentional rather than confusing. This consistency reassures customers that the restaurant is well-managed and reliable, encouraging repeat visits and positive word-of-mouth.
Customer Experience Beyond Food
Modern diners value the overall experience as much as the food itself. Factors such as cleanliness, staff behavior, ambiance, and speed of service significantly influence satisfaction. Restaurants that focus on customer comfort and engagement often outperform competitors, even if their prices are slightly higher. A well-trained team, clear menu presentation, and thoughtful branding all contribute to a smoother dining journey. These elements work together to turn a simple meal into a memorable experience.
Digital Influence on Restaurant Choices
The rise of digital platforms has transformed how customers discover and evaluate restaurants. Online menus, reviews, and social media presence strongly impact decision-making. Customers often check menu updates, prices, and visuals before visiting. Restaurants that keep their digital information current and aligned with in-store offerings appear more professional and trustworthy. This digital consistency helps attract new customers and retain existing ones in an increasingly online-driven market.
Adapting to Changing Consumer Preferences
Consumer preferences evolve rapidly, influenced by health trends, economic factors, and cultural shifts. Restaurants that adapt quickly by updating menus, refining branding, and improving service stay relevant. Flexibility allows brands to cater to new tastes while maintaining their core identity. Whether it’s adding new flavors, adjusting portion sizes, or refreshing visual elements, adaptation shows that a restaurant values its customers and listens to their needs.
